Destin Water Users Elevated Water Storage Tank
This Destin Water users project was a multi-phase, multi-year project that included the construction, surface preparation, and painting of a new 750,000 gallon elevated potable water storage Tower #5 near Choctawhatchee Bay. The project was broken into separate construction and painting contracts for quality control and cost saving purposes. The total final project cost of the painting portion was $781,637 including full mural. US Highway 84 ATRIP2 Improvements
Poly provided planning, design, and construction phase services for the Highway 84 widening project in Dothan, AL. The project was needed to increase the capacity of US-84 to accommodate recent and projected growth on the west side of Dothan. The project included adding a westbound through lane, intersection improvements at Woodburn Dr., access management improvements at median openings and driveways, and resurfacing of all westbound pavement. Steve Williams Arena
Poly provided planning, design, and construction phase services for the new Steve Williams Arena which is located in downtown Headland, Alabama. The new Arena is a 30,198 SF facility conveniently sited between Headland High School and Headland Elementary School. The Arena was designed to serve as both a first-class basketball and volleyball sporting venue providing 1,752 spectator seats, a collegiate basketball court, and two regulation volleyball courts.
